Web12.4: Pigments and Evolutionary Adaptations. Cyanobacteria were potentially the first organisms to do oxygenic photosynthesis -- the variety of photosynthesis that produces oxygen as a waste product. To do this, cyanobacteria use the pigment chlorophyll a. This is the only pigment directly involved in photosynthesis, but other pigments called ... WebMar 24, 2024 · Chlorophyll a is the primary light-absorbing pigment in plant leaves. It absorbs light wavelengths in the red and blue range, and reflects back green waves, which gives most leaves their distinctive green color. WebChlorophylls are greenish pigments which contain a porphyrin ring. This is a stable ring-shaped molecule around which electrons are free to migrate.
